Poetry Analysis on Stylistic Grounds - A Survey


K Praveen Kumar,Venkata Naresh Mandhala,Debrup Banerjee,T.Maruthi Padmaja
Abstract

In natural language processing expressing the style of poetry is a challenging task, it is better possible with studying the stylometric features or various literary devices of Poetry. These features can be computed using computational linguistic methods. In this survey the authors provide an overall picture of various methods and features used to analyze the poetry in various countries languages. The features include meter, imagery, rhythm, rhyme, and metaphor. In this work we also discussed different classification tasks employed using these features includes poetry style detection, subject based poetry classification and author ship attribution. Finally discuss the importance of the features in success of applications and touch upon the limitations of the methods based on their applications.
